SLS parameters

Select the SLS Parameters tab from the New Reinforcement Parameters dialog.

Note: Cracking is calculated independently in two directions on the basis of equivalent moments (see: Cracking of Plates and Shells - Calculations).

Deflection in plates is calculated on the basis of the ratio of elastic stiffness to the stiffness determined on the basis of the phase of RC element work (see: Deflections of plates and shells - calculations).

Deflection of RC plates is identified with displacement. While working in 3D with plates and shells or while using elastic supports in the 2D plate module, pay attention to the displacement of supports that may change the value of actual deflections.
